I have the Gen. 2 and there not that bad. I had blue bulbs in and they sucked, I recently put my factory bulbs back in for inspection and there isn't much difference between the factory housings and the Gen. 2's. I did notice on high beams the Gen. 2 seem to be a little brighter, but on low's a didn't notice a difference.
 
Here is a picture from JC whitney, they are similar to the ones I have. The only difference is that mine are black but they are paintable like the picture shows and also the eclipse lamps come with a clear plastic cover. I don't think the projection is any different they just look sweet. Also the drivers side is a pain cause their is what I believe a AC line that makes it difficult to get the drivers side hi beam to lock in securly. I just bent the line a little bit to get the hi beam to lock in.

irjoshy - I'll take some daytime pics tomorrow, someone else has already asked me to so it won't be a problem. Also, they ARE those projectors you linked to on eBay, but black housing instead, and yes, the light output is quite a bit better than stock, even with the cheap bulbs they come with.

TJones12 - nearly all projectors are made for 97-99, even mine. You just can't see the gap in the picture because it's dark, but even in the daytime it is hardly noticeable unless you're looking for it, because behind the gap is black as well.

^^^Yeah, be sure to get some like that. Alot of the projectors made for the eclipse will use the H3 bulb. That lighting is so terrible! Same bulb for the 2gb fogs, so you can imagine.

Mine use H3s fow low beam, and H1s for high beam. Like I said before, the light output is better than stock, I'm assuming they used some better projectors this time around.
